What's Happening?
Qualcomm has introduced its latest Snapdragon X Series chips, designed specifically for laptops, alongside a new system-on-a-chip for flagship phones. The Snapdragon X2 Elite Extreme chip is targeted at ultra-premium Windows 11 laptops, capable of handling complex workloads and providing fast AI processing with extended battery life. The chips come in two variants, featuring 18 and 12 total cores, respectively. Qualcomm claims these processors are the fastest and most efficient for Windows PCs. The Snapdragon X Elite chip, launched in 2023, marked a significant performance leap from its predecessor, the Snapdragon 8cx Gen 3. Microsoft has already released Copilot+ PCs equipped with these chips, and Qualcomm showcased the Snapdragon X for Copilot+ PCs at CES earlier this year.

What's Next?
The first laptops powered by the Snapdragon X2 Elite processors are expected to be available in the first half of 2026.
